Responsibilities

The aim of the role is acting as a real Finance Business Partner of the Plant manager being a foundation for the business’ decision-making process. You are expected to ensure accuracy of financial statements in line with local accounting standards and to oversee all financial planning and analysis and forecasting performances.

  • Collaborating with managers to develop budgets for the business, and monitoring actual performance versus budget and report variances to management
  • Standard costing
  • Performing accurate and timely period closing process
  • Process invoicing, payments and payroll activities
  • Working closely with departments across the organization, as well as external parties such as vendors, consultants, customers, auditors
  • Developing financial models and cash flow projections
  • Analyzing financial results each month to prepare monthly reports for the management team, Business unit Board and Group Board as well year-end financial statements
  • Driving standardization and digitalization within factory accounting, reconciliation, master data management, reporting to management

Profile

  • Education in financial and/or economics field
  • Finance and/or accounting background
  • Knowledge of Swiss GAAP and IFRS principles
  • Fluent in Italian and English is a must
  • German as an advantage
  • High level IT skills (excel, SAP)
  • Able to communicate to all levels
  • Open minded person with a continuous Improvement mindset
  • Project Management skills
  • Positive, trustworthy and not afraid to take responsibility
  • Willing to learn and develop yourself on the job
